Salutare, pasionați de tehnologie și curioși ai lumii digitale! 🚀 V-ați întrebat vreodată cum ar fi să puteți rula mai multe sisteme de operare pe același calculator, simultan și fără bătăi de cap? Sau poate aveți nevoie să testați o aplicație într-un mediu izolat, fără să vă afectați sistemul principal? Ei bine, răspunsul la aceste întrebări, și la multe altele, stă într-un concept magic numit virtualizare, iar poarta de intrare în acest univers este adesea Oracle VM VirtualBox.
În acest ghid detaliat, vom explora împreună primii pași în virtualizare, învățând cum să instalăm și să configurăm VirtualBox, un instrument gratuit și puternic, accesibil oricui. Pregătiți-vă să descoperiți o modalitate fascinantă de a extinde capacitățile calculatorului vostru!
Ce este VirtualBox și de ce ne-ar interesa? 🤔
Pe scurt, Oracle VM VirtualBox este un software de virtualizare open-source, dezvoltat de Oracle. Acesta permite crearea și rularea unor medii virtualizate, cunoscute sub denumirea de mașini virtuale (MV-uri), pe un sistem de operare existent (numit „gazdă” sau „host”). Fiecare mașină virtuală se comportă ca un calculator fizic independent, cu propriile sale resurse virtuale (procesor, memorie RAM, stocare, placă de rețea etc.), pe care putem instala un alt sistem de operare (numit „invitat” sau „guest”).
De ce ar fi asta util? Imaginați-vă următoarele scenarii:
- 💻 Vreți să încercați cea mai nouă versiune de Linux, dar nu doriți să o instalați direct pe hard diskul principal.
- 🧪 Sunteți dezvoltator și aveți nevoie să testați o aplicație pe diferite versiuni de Windows sau Linux, fără a avea multiple calculatoare fizice.
- 🛡️ Vreți să navigați pe internet într-un mediu izolat, pentru a vă proteja sistemul principal de potențiale amenințări.
- 🕹️ Doriți să rulați software mai vechi, compatibil doar cu sisteme de operare depășite, pe un computer modern.
VirtualBox transformă toate aceste scenarii în realitate, oferindu-vă flexibilitate și control.
Cerințe de sistem: Ce avem nevoie? 💡
Pentru a rula VirtualBox în condiții optime, sistemul vostru gazdă ar trebui să îndeplinească anumite cerințe minime:
- Sistem de operare gazdă (Host OS): VirtualBox este compatibil cu Windows, macOS, Linux și Solaris.
- Memorie RAM: Minim 4 GB, dar pentru o experiență fluidă cu MV-uri, 8 GB sau mai mult sunt recomandate. Rețineți că memoria RAM alocată MV-ului se „taie” din cea a sistemului gazdă.
- Spațiu de stocare: Suficient spațiu liber pe disc pentru instalarea VirtualBox în sine, plus cel puțin 15-20 GB pentru fiecare mașină virtuală, în funcție de sistemul de operare invitat și aplicațiile instalate.
- Procesor: Un procesor modern (Intel sau AMD) cu suport pentru virtualizare hardware (VT-x pentru Intel sau AMD-V pentru AMD). Această caracteristică este esențială pentru performanță și, de obicei, trebuie activată în BIOS/UEFI.
Pasul 1: Descărcarea Oracle VM VirtualBox ⬇️
Primul pas este, desigur, procurarea software-ului. Accesați site-ul oficial Oracle VM VirtualBox.
Căutați secțiunea de descărcare (Download) și alegeți pachetul potrivit pentru sistemul vostru de operare gazdă. De exemplu, dacă folosiți Windows, veți descărca „Windows hosts”.
Este recomandat să descărcați și VirtualBox Extension Pack. Acesta adaugă funcționalități suplimentare, cum ar fi suport USB 2.0/3.0, RDP (Remote Desktop Protocol), criptare de disc și alte caracteristici utile. Asigurați-vă că versiunea Extension Pack corespunde exact cu versiunea de VirtualBox pe care o instalați.
Pasul 2: Instalarea Oracle VM VirtualBox 🛠️
Procesul de instalare este destul de simplu și intuitiv, similar cu majoritatea aplicațiilor. Voi prezenta pașii pentru Windows, dar logica este aceeași pentru alte sisteme de operare:
- Executați fișierul descărcat: Faceți dublu clic pe fișierul
.exe
(sau.dmg
pentru macOS,.deb
/.rpm
pentru Linux). - Ecranul de bun venit: Dați clic pe „Next” pentru a începe procesul.
- Componente personalizate: Lăsați, de obicei, toate componentele selectate implicit. Acestea includ suport pentru USB, rețea și Python. Dați clic pe „Next”.
- Locația de instalare: Puteți alege o altă locație, dar calea implicită este, în general, perfectă. „Next”.
- Opțiuni de instalare: Lăsați bifate opțiunile pentru scurtături pe desktop și în meniul Start, dacă doriți. „Next”.
- Avertisment privind interfețele de rețea: Veți primi un avertisment că instalarea va reseta temporar interfețele de rețea. Nu vă panicați, este normal și necesar pentru funcționalitatea de rețea a MV-urilor. Confirmați cu „Yes”.
- Gata de instalare: Apăsați „Install”. Este posibil să vi se ceară permisiuni de administrator și să confirmați instalarea driverelor de dispozitiv Oracle. Acceptați-le.
- Finalizare: După ce instalarea este completă, puteți bifa opțiunea „Start Oracle VM VirtualBox after installation” și apăsați „Finish”.
Apoi, nu uitați să instalați Extension Pack! După ce VirtualBox este pornit, mergeți la File > Tools > Extension Pack Manager
, apoi Install
și selectați fișierul .vbox-extpack
descărcat anterior. Acceptați termenii și condițiile.
Pasul 3: Crearea primei mașini virtuale ⚙️
Acum că avem VirtualBox instalat, haideți să creăm o mașină virtuală! 🚀
- Deschideți VirtualBox: Din meniul Start sau de pe desktop.
- Butonul „New”: Veți vedea o interfață principală curată. Dați clic pe butonul „New” (sau „Nou” în română), de obicei reprezentat de un plus verde.
- Nume și sistem de operare:
- Nume: Alegeți un nume descriptiv pentru MV-ul vostru (ex: „Ubuntu 22.04”, „Windows 10 Test”).
- Folder mașină: Locația unde vor fi stocate fișierele MV-ului. Puteți lăsa implicit sau alege o altă locație cu suficient spațiu.
- Imagine ISO: Aici veți selecta fișierul
.iso
al sistemului de operare pe care doriți să-l instalați. VirtualBox va încerca să detecteze automat tipul și versiunea sistemului de operare. - Tip și Versiune: Dacă nu a fost detectat automat, alegeți manual Tipul (ex: Linux, Microsoft Windows) și Versiunea (ex: Ubuntu 64-bit, Windows 10 64-bit).
Dați clic pe „Next”.
- Hardware:
- Memorie de bază (RAM): Alocați memorie RAM pentru MV. Nu depășiți niciodată jumătate din memoria RAM totală a sistemului vostru gazdă, și asigurați-vă că lăsați suficientă memorie pentru sistemul gazdă însuși (minim 4 GB pentru Windows 10 gazdă, de exemplu). Pentru Windows 10 MV, 4 GB sunt un bun punct de plecare.
- Procesoare: Alocați numărul de nuclee de procesor. Un singur nucleu este suficient pentru majoritatea sistemelor de operare invitate pentru sarcini ușoare, dar 2 sau mai multe vor oferi o performanță mai bună. Nu alocați mai multe nuclee decât aveți fizic pe procesorul gazdă.
Dați clic pe „Next”.
- Hard disk virtual:
- Creați un hard disk virtual acum: Aceasta este opțiunea cea mai comună. Lăsați bifat.
- Dimensiune: Alocați spațiu de stocare pentru MV. Pentru Windows 10, minim 50-60 GB este recomandat. Pentru majoritatea distribuțiilor Linux, 20-30 GB sunt suficienți. Rețineți că VirtualBox folosește implicit discuri dinamic alocate (dynamically allocated), ceea ce înseamnă că fișierul de disc virtual va crește pe măsură ce este utilizat spațiu, până la dimensiunea maximă specificată.
Dați clic pe „Next” și apoi „Finish”.
Felicitări! Ați creat scheletul primei voastre mașini virtuale! Acum trebuie să o configurăm mai în detaliu.
Pasul 4: Configurarea esențială a mașinii virtuale ✅
Înainte de a porni MV-ul, e bine să verificăm și să ajustăm câteva setări. Selectați MV-ul din lista din stânga și dați clic pe butonul „Settings” (Setări):
- Sistem (System):
- Placă de bază (Motherboard): Puteți ajusta ordinea de boot (de exemplu, să booteze de pe CD/DVD, apoi de pe hard disk).
- Procesor (Processor): Reconfirmați numărul de procesoare alocate. Asigurați-vă că opțiunea „Enable VT-x/AMD-V” este bifată (dacă este disponibilă), pentru accelerare hardware.
- Afișare (Display):
- Memorie video (Video Memory): Măriți memoria video, mai ales dacă doriți o rezoluție mai mare sau accelerare grafică. 128 MB sau chiar 256 MB pot îmbunătăți semnificativ experiența vizuală.
- Activați Accelerarea 3D (Enable 3D Acceleration): Bifați această opțiune pentru performanțe grafice sporite, utilă în special după instalarea Guest Additions.
- Stocare (Storage):
- Aici vedeți hard diskul virtual și unitatea optică. Asigurați-vă că sub „Controller: IDE” sau „Controller: SATA” (depinde de configurare), „Empty” (Gol) este selectat. Dați clic pe iconița de disc de pe partea dreaptă și alegeți „Choose a disk file…” (Alegeți un fișier disc…) pentru a monta imaginea
.iso
a sistemului de operare invitat. Aceasta va permite MV-ului să booteze de pe imaginea de instalare.
- Aici vedeți hard diskul virtual și unitatea optică. Asigurați-vă că sub „Controller: IDE” sau „Controller: SATA” (depinde de configurare), „Empty” (Gol) este selectat. Dați clic pe iconița de disc de pe partea dreaptă și alegeți „Choose a disk file…” (Alegeți un fișier disc…) pentru a monta imaginea
- Rețea (Network):
- Adaptor 1 (Adapter 1):
- NAT (Network Address Translation): Aceasta este setarea implicită și cea mai simplă. MV-ul va primi o adresă IP privată și va accesa internetul prin intermediul sistemului gazdă. Nu este direct vizibilă în rețeaua locală. Ideală pentru navigare simplă pe internet.
- Bridge Adapter (Adaptor în punte): MV-ul va acționa ca un calculator fizic separat în rețeaua voastră locală, obținând propria adresă IP de la router. Util pentru a accesa resurse din rețea sau pentru a permite altor dispozitive să acceseze MV-ul.
- Host-only Adapter (Adaptor doar gazdă): Creează o rețea internă între sistemul gazdă și MV-uri, fără acces la internetul exterior. Util pentru dezvoltare sau teste izolate.
Pentru majoritatea utilizatorilor noi, NAT este suficient.
- Adaptor 1 (Adapter 1):
- Porturi USB (USB):
- Permite MV-ului să acceseze dispozitive USB conectate la sistemul gazdă. Asigurați-vă că ați instalat Extension Pack pentru suport USB 2.0/3.0.
- Dossiers partagés (Shared Folders):
- O funcționalitate extrem de utilă pentru a partaja fișiere între sistemul gazdă și MV. Adăugați un folder de pe sistemul gazdă și setați-l ca „Auto-mount”. Această funcționalitate necesită Guest Additions pentru a funcționa.
După ce ați ajustat setările, dați clic pe „OK”.
Pasul 5: Instalarea sistemului de operare invitat 💾
Acum vine partea cea mai interesantă! Selectați MV-ul și apăsați butonul „Start” (Pornire). O nouă fereastră se va deschide, reprezentând monitorul calculatorului virtual.
MV-ul va boota de pe imaginea ISO pe care ați montat-o în pasul 4 (la secțiunea „Stocare”), iar procesul de instalare a sistemului de operare invitat va începe, exact ca pe un calculator fizic. Urmați instrucțiunile de pe ecran pentru instalarea sistemului de operare ales (Windows, Ubuntu, etc.). Acest proces este standard pentru fiecare SO și nu diferă de instalarea sa pe hardware fizic.
Sfaturi rapide pentru instalare:
- Când MV-ul captează mouse-ul și tastatura, puteți reveni la sistemul gazdă apăsând tasta „Host Key” (de obicei Right Ctrl, dar o puteți verifica în meniul
File > Preferences > Input > Virtual Machine
). - Instalarea SO-ului invitat durează, în general, mai mult decât pe hardware fizic, în funcție de resursele alocate și viteza hard diskului gazdă.
Pasul 6: Instalarea VirtualBox Guest Additions 🌟
Aceasta este o etapă CRUCIALĂ pentru o experiență optimă cu mașinile virtuale! VirtualBox Guest Additions sunt un set de drivere și utilitare speciale, concepute pentru a îmbunătăți performanța și integrarea sistemului de operare invitat cu sistemul gazdă.
Beneficiile includ:
- ✅ Rezoluție de ecran dinamică (ecran complet).
- ✅ Suport pentru copiere/lipire (Shared Clipboard) bidirecțional.
- ✅ Drag-and-drop (glisare și fixare) între gazdă și invitat.
- ✅ Performanță grafică și de rețea mult îmbunătățită.
- ✅ Suport pentru Shared Folders (Dossiers partagés).
Cum se instalează:
- Odată ce sistemul de operare invitat este instalat și rulează, din meniul VirtualBox (fereastra MV-ului), navigați la
Devices > Insert Guest Additions CD Image...
(Dispozitive > Inserare imagine CD Guest Additions…). - În interiorul sistemului de operare invitat, se va monta o unitate CD virtuală. Deschideți-o și executați programul de instalare corespunzător sistemului de operare (de exemplu,
VBoxWindowsAdditions.exe
pentru Windows, sau rulați scriptulVBoxLinuxAdditions.run
pentru Linux). - Urmați pașii de instalare. Este posibil să fie necesară o repornire a sistemului invitat după finalizare.
Sfaturi și trucuri pentru utilizare optimă 🧠
Pentru a profita la maximum de VirtualBox, iată câteva sfaturi:
- Snapshots (Instantanee): Această funcționalitate este extraordinară! Puteți crea un „instantaneu” al stării MV-ului la un anumit moment. Dacă testați ceva riscant sau instalați un software nou și ceva nu merge bine, puteți oricând să reveniți la instantaneul anterior. Este ca un „undo” pentru întreaga mașină virtuală!
- Clonare (Cloning): Vă permite să creați o copie exactă a unei MV existente. Utila pentru a experimenta cu setări diferite sau pentru a avea mai multe instanțe ale aceluiași mediu.
- Backup regulat: Deși VirtualBox este stabil, este întotdeauna o idee bună să faceți backup fișierelor
.vdi
(sau formatului de disc virtual pe care îl folosiți) și fișierelor de configurare.vbox
ale MV-urilor importante. - Resurse alocate: Ajustați întotdeauna resursele (RAM, CPU) în funcție de nevoile sistemului de operare invitat și de capacitatea sistemului gazdă. Un SO invitat cu resurse insuficiente va fi lent, dar alocarea excesivă va afecta performanța sistemului gazdă.
„Virtualizarea nu este doar o tehnologie, ci o filozofie ce redefinește modul în care interacționăm cu sistemele informatice. Oferă o libertate de experimentare și o flexibilitate operațională care ar fi fost inimaginabile acum câteva decenii.”
O privire de ansamblu personală: De ce VirtualBox continuă să domine 🌍
Din experiența mea și analizând tendințele din comunitatea tehnică, VirtualBox rămâne o opțiune extrem de populară și valoroasă. Datele de descărcare și numărul mare de utilizatori activi pe forumuri confirmă că este o soluție preferată pentru virtualizare desktop. Gratuitatea sa este, desigur, un factor major, dar stabilitatea, ușurința în utilizare și suita completă de funcționalități pe care le oferă – de la suport pentru diverse sisteme de operare gazdă și invitat, până la funcții avansate precum Snapshots și Shared Folders – îl fac un punct de plecare ideal pentru oricine dorește să exploreze lumea virtualizării. Chiar dacă există alternative comerciale cu funcții de enterprise, pentru uz personal și teste, VirtualBox oferă un raport calitate-preț (sau mai degrabă calitate-gratuitate) imbatabil.
Concluzie 🏁
Ați parcurs acum primii și cei mai importanți pași în utilizarea Oracle VM VirtualBox! De la descărcare și instalare, până la crearea și configurarea unei mașini virtuale și instalarea sistemului de operare invitat, ați dobândit abilitățile necesare pentru a vă aventura în lumea virtualizării.
Nu ezitați să experimentați! Creați MV-uri, instalați diferite sisteme de operare, testați software nou. Această platformă este un sandbox perfect pentru învățare și dezvoltare, fără riscul de a afecta sistemul vostru principal. Sper ca acest ghid să vă fie un punct de plecare excelent în călătoria voastră virtuală. Succes! 🌟